Nutrition is the key ! You have to eat right in order to see results... Usually the bodybuilding diet should be high with protein, so protein powders are very good choice and so convenient for everybody's lifestyle... Whey protein has proven to be the best. Casein protein is good too, though it's mainly used before bed since it's slow digesting... Take a multivitamin and maybe some fish oil and you'll be good, other than these, most supplements are BS...

The problem here isn't with the protein supplements... when you start training and lifting weights, your body needs of amino acids increases, usually it's recommended to consume 1 gram of protein for every 2 kg of body weight (es. 75 Kg person consumes 150 grams of protein) divided evenly to 5 or 6 meals... but when you get back to your usual eating habits and consuming bad foods, you will lose the muscles since your body is in continuous need of amino acids... Muscles are hard to get and easy to lose... there are plenty of protein sources (chicken, beef, fish, eggs, milk, cheese, protein powders, etc).. but who have the time to eat every 3 hours ? so here comes the importance of protein supplements, easy to have and easy to drink... Plus protein powders are very good for your health, all this crap about it being bad for you is just a myth !

Mainly pre-workout supplements contain "L-Arginine Alpha Ketoglutarate" (nitric oxide booster) helps with the blood flow and warming up the body, plus stimulants like caffeine... I never used these kind of supplements since I work out in the evening, so taking caffeine at night would affect my sleep... The quote you posted is mainly advertising :p , and the warning of not taking more than one scoop is to make sure to not take too much caffeine... It's not a bad idea to try such supplements, but don't stay on it because I feel they are waste of money... Get caffeine pills instead, they would be a good alternative and way more cheaper...
